The Foundation of Your Skincare Wardrobe: The Non-Negotiables
Before we dive into seasonal specifics, let’s establish the core essentials that should always be in your skincare arsenal. These are the pieces that form the foundation of your routine, and they should be adapted, not abandoned, with each season.
- A Gentle Cleanser: The first step to any healthy routine. It removes dirt, oil, and impurities without stripping your skin of its natural moisture.
- A Hydrating Moisturizer: Locks in moisture and fortifies your skin’s protective barrier. The texture and weight of this product will be the first thing you adapt seasonally.
- Sunscreen: This is non-negotiable. The sun’s UV rays are powerful all year round in Nigeria, and wearing a broad-spectrum sunscreen with at least SPF 30 is the single most important thing you can do for your skin. It protects against sunburn, premature aging, and hyperpigmentation.
- A Targeted Treatment: This could be a serum or an essence designed to address a specific concern, such as hyperpigmentation, acne, or fine lines.
With these foundational pieces in mind, let’s build your seasonal skincare wardrobe.
Dressing for the Harmattan Wardrobe (November – February)
The Harmattan is arguably the most challenging season for the skin. The cold, dry, and dusty winds strip the air of moisture, leading to a host of common skin issues.
The Climate: Dry, cold, and dusty winds. Very low humidity. Common Skin Concerns:
- Extreme dryness, flakiness, and a tight, uncomfortable feeling.
- Chapped lips and cracked heels.
- Eczema and other inflammatory skin conditions may flare up.
- Increased sensitivity and irritation.
Your Harmattan Skincare Strategy: Focus on Intense Hydration and Barrier Protection.
- Switch to a Creamy Cleanser: Abandon your harsh, foaming cleansers. They will only strip away precious moisture. Opt for a hydrating, cream-based, or oil cleanser that cleans without leaving your skin feeling tight and dry.
- Layer with Hydration: This is the season for layering. After cleansing, apply a hydrating essence or toner (one without alcohol) to prep your skin. Follow this with a serum rich in humectants like hyaluronic acid or glycerin to draw moisture into the skin.
- Seal with a Rich Moisturizer: Your lightweight moisturizer from the rainy season won’t cut it. Look for a thick, nourishing moisturizer or a face oil to seal in all the moisture. Ingredients like shea butter, coconut oil, and ceramides are your best friends.
- Embrace Body Butters: For your body, nothing beats the power of a rich body butter. Apply it generously to your hands, feet, and knees to prevent flaking and cracking.
- Don’t Forget the Lips and Sunscreen: A good lip balm is a must to prevent painful chapping. And even though the air is cold, the sun’s UV rays are still powerful. Reapply your broad-spectrum sunscreen diligently, especially if you spend time outdoors.

Dressing for the Rainy Season Wardrobe (April – October)
The Rainy Season brings a welcome relief from the heat, but the high humidity presents its own unique set of skincare challenges.
The Climate: High humidity, cooler temperatures, frequent rain, and cloudy days. Common Skin Concerns:
- Increased oiliness and a greasy feeling.
- Clogged pores, leading to breakouts and acne.
- Fungal and bacterial infections due to sweat and moisture trapped on the skin.
- Hyperpigmentation.
Your Rainy Season Skincare Strategy: Focus on Balancing, Clarifying, and Lightweight Hydration.
- Deep Cleanse with a Foaming Cleanser: The humidity and increased sweating mean your skin needs a thorough cleanse. A gentle foaming or gel-based cleanser is perfect for removing excess oil, dirt, and sweat without over-drying. - Lightweight Moisturizer is Key: Put away the heavy creams and butters. Switch to a lightweight, water-based, or gel moisturizer. These will provide essential hydration without feeling greasy or clogging your pores. Look for products that are non-comedogenic.
- Embrace Exfoliation: To combat clogged pores and breakouts, incorporate a gentle exfoliator into your routine. A BHA (Beta Hydroxy Acid) toner or serum is excellent for penetrating deep into pores to dissolve oil and dead skin cells.
- Use Masks for Clarification: A clay or charcoal mask once or twice a week can work wonders to draw out impurities and control shine.
- Sunscreen is Still a Must: Don’t be fooled by the cloudy skies. UV rays still penetrate the clouds and can cause sun damage. Continue to use your broad-spectrum sunscreen every single day.

Dressing for the Dry Season (Hot Season) Wardrobe (March – April)
This short but intense period is defined by scorching heat and abundant sunshine. It’s a time when you feel like you are literally walking in the sun, and your skin needs all the help it can get.
The Climate: Extremely hot and sunny. Lower humidity than the rainy season, but not as dry as the Harmattan. Common Skin Concerns:
- Sunburn and sun damage.
- Dehydration, even though you’re sweating.
- Increased oil production due to heat.
- Hyperpigmentation from sun exposure.
Your Hot Season Skincare Strategy: Focus on Protection, Cooling, and Soothing.
- Prioritize Sunscreen Above All Else: This is the most crucial time for sun protection. Reapply your broad-spectrum sunscreen every 2-3 hours, especially if you are outdoors. Consider wearing a sun hat and sunglasses for extra protection.
- Cleanse Gently: Sweating can lead to breakouts, so a good cleanse to remove impurities is necessary. However, avoid over-cleansing, which can lead to dehydration.
- Lightweight and Soothing Hydration: Opt for moisturizers with a light, fluid texture that won’t feel heavy on your skin. Look for soothing ingredients like aloe vera or cucumber extract to calm and cool the skin. A facial mist can also be a great way to refresh and rehydrate your skin throughout the day.
- Keep it Simple: During this period, your skin is already under a lot of stress. Avoid using too many active ingredients. Stick to a simple routine of cleansing, moisturizing, and protecting.
